The judges Shamgar and Barak. Shamgar holds an ox-goad in his hand and in the background he kills six hundred Philistines with it. Barak is dressed in armor and holds a scepter in his hand. On the right in the background Jael kills Sisera by driving a tent peg through his head while he sleeps. Below the image explanatory texts in Latin. This print is part of an album.
